Richards v. Steuben County Jail et al
Plaintiff: Justin Craig Richards
Defendant: Steuben County Jail, Maxwell Hamilton and Huffnagle
Case Number: 1:2022cv00313
Filed: September 14, 2022
Court: US District Court for the Northern District of Indiana
Presiding Judge: Holly A Brady
Referring Judge: Susan L Collins
Nature of Suit: Prisoner: Civil Rights
Cause of Action: 42 U.S.C. ยง 1983 Prisoner Civil Rights
Jury Demanded By: None

Date Filed Document Text
November 1, 2022 Filing 5 CLERK'S ENTRY OF JUDGMENT. (Copy mailed to pro se party) (sej)
October 31, 2022 Opinion or Order Filing 4 ORDER: The court DISMISSES this case WITH PREJUDICE pursuant to 28 U.S.C. 1915A because the complaint does not state a claim upon which relief can be granted; ORDERS the plaintiff, Justin Craig Richards, Steuben County Jail # 502-04081, IDOC # unknown, to pay (and the facility having custody to automatically remit) to the clerk 20% of the money received for each calendar month during which $10.00 or more is received, until the $402.00 filing fee is paid in full; DIRECTS the clerk to create a ledger for receipt of these funds; and DIRECTS the clerk to send a copy of this order to each facility where the plaintiff is housed until the filing fee has been paid in full. Signed by Judge Holly A Brady on 10/31/2022. (Copy mailed to pro se party and Steuben County Jail: Inmate Trust Fund)(sej)
September 20, 2022 Opinion or Order Filing 3 ORDER DENYING #2 MOTION for Leave to Proceed in forma pauperis with leave to refile by 10/19/2022. GRANTING Justin Craig Richards until 10/19/2022, to file an amended complaint; and CAUTIONS Justin Craig Richards if he does not respond by the deadline, this case will be dismissed pursuant to 28 U.S.C. 1915A without further notice because the current complaint does not state a claim for which relief can be granted. Signed by Judge Holly A Brady on 9/20/2022. (Copy mailed to pro se party)(ash)
September 14, 2022 Filing 2 MOTION for Leave to Proceed in forma pauperis by Plaintiff Justin Craig Richards. (Attachments: #1 Envelope)(mrm)
September 14, 2022 Filing 1 PRO SE COMPLAINT against Steuben County Jail, Maxwell Hamilton, Captain Huffnagle, filed by Justin Craig Richards. (Returned file stamped copy with case number to Richards) (Attachments: #1 Envelope)(mrm)
